Transaction 1020e74c18bca51b81ebf347d25149c778be19172976e700b7aea232d77cbe3f
1 Input
1 Output
-
1020e74c18bca51b81ebf347d25149c778be19172976e700b7aea232d77cbe3f:0
- value
- 987898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6b18e43796f79d4df76301743be44f15b1a826f OP_EQUAL
- address
- 3GtQoB7JdEVNS5PBXTKacPHtmA94ZKTwoQ